Phaser 6500/WorkCentre 6505 Service Manual Xerox Internal Use Only 4-57
General Troubleshooting
CNG Stop Select Sets the conditions for stopping CNG
transmission. Conditions:
CED&V21: When CED and V.21
preamble are detected.
CED: When CED is detected.
V21: When V.21 preamble is
detected.
G3M TX Cable
EQU
Sets the cable amplitude equalizer
value for transmission. These values
are available:
0db Equal to a cable length of 0km.
4db Equal to a cable length of 1.9km
8db Equal to a cable length of 3.6km
12db Equal to a cable length of 7.2km
G3M RX Cable
EQU
Sets the cable amplitude equalizer
value for reception (applicable to V17,
V29, and V27ter) These values are
available:
0db Equal to a cable length of 0km.
4db Equal to a cable length of 1.9km
8db Equal to a cable length of 3.6km
12db Equal to a cable length of 7.2km
G3M V34 Bit
Rate
Sets the signaling rate for the Super
G3 (V34) mode. Values range from
2400bps to 33600bps in 14 steps.
2400/4800/7200/9600/12000/
14400/16800/19200/21600/24000/
26400/28800/31200/33600
Capability V34 Sets the communication capability of
the Super G3 (V34) mode.
G3M TX Coding Sets the data encoding method for
transmission. When the encoding
method set here is not supported by
the receiving side, the receiving side's
method is adopted. Available
methods: are MH/MR/ MMR/JBIG
G3M RX Coding Sets the data encoding method for
reception. Available methods: are
MH/MR/ MMR/JBIG
BackUp Data NOTE The system data initialization does not initialize data on
EEPROM (except dial types and country codes). The
counter clear does not clear scan counter clearance on
EEPROM; it only clears counters on SRAM.
